Atrial electromechanical delay and p wave dispersion associated with severity of chronic obstructive pulmonary disease.

Abstract

BACKGROUND

The aim of this study was to evaluate atrial electromechanical delay (AEMD) with both electrocardiography (ECG) and echocardiography in patients with Chronic Obstructive Pulmonary Disease (COPD).

METHODS

Total of 110 patients were included in this cross-sectional case-control study. P-wave dispersion (PWD) was measured on a 12-lead ECG. Atrial electromechanical intervals (PA) were measured as the time interval between the onset of the P wave on the ECG and the beginning of the late diastolic A wave.

RESULTS

PWD was found to be 40.9±9.2 ms in the healthy control group, 45.6±8.2 ms in the mild COPD and 44.8±8.7 ms in the severe COPD group (p<0.05). Intra-right atrial EMD was found to be 10.7±5.8 ms in mild COPD, 11.0±7 ms in severe COPD, and it was 16.4±7.3 ms in healthy control group (p<0.001). Interatrial EMD was detected to be 29.5±9.1 ms in the control group, 24.1±9 ms in mild COPD group, and 23.9±11.1 ms in the severe COPD group (p<0.001).

CONCLUSION

Both mild and severe COPD groups decreased PWD, increased tricuspid PA and significantly decreased interand right intra-AEMD times in comparison to the control group.

摘要

背景

本研究旨在评估慢性阻塞性肺疾病(COPD)患者的心电图(ECG)和超声心动图的心房机电延迟(AEMD)。

方法

本横断面病例对照研究共纳入 110 例患者。在 12 导联心电图上测量 P 波离散度(PWD)。心房机电间隔(PA)测量为心电图上 P 波起始与舒张晚期 A 波起始之间的时间间隔。

结果

健康对照组的 PWD 为 40.9±9.2ms,轻度 COPD 组为 45.6±8.2ms,重度 COPD 组为 44.8±8.7ms(p<0.05)。轻度 COPD 组右心房内 EMD 为 10.7±5.8ms,重度 COPD 组为 11.0±7ms,健康对照组为 16.4±7.3ms(p<0.001)。对照组的房间隔 EMD 为 29.5±9.1ms,轻度 COPD 组为 24.1±9ms,重度 COPD 组为 23.9±11.1ms(p<0.001)。

结论

与对照组相比,轻度和重度 COPD 组均降低了 PWD,增加了三尖瓣 PA,并显著缩短了房间隔和右心房内 AEMD 时间。
